M. Tsukada is a scholar working on Electrical and Electronic Engineering, Molecular Biology and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, M. Tsukada has authored 43 papers receiving a total of 342 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Electrical and Electronic Engineering, 5 papers in Molecular Biology and 5 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in M. Tsukada's work include Advanced Optical Network Technologies (22 papers), Optical Network Technologies (22 papers) and Advanced Photonic Communication Systems (21 papers). M. Tsukada is often cited by papers focused on Advanced Optical Network Technologies (22 papers), Optical Network Technologies (22 papers) and Advanced Photonic Communication Systems (21 papers). M. Tsukada collaborates with scholars based in Japan, Australia and Algeria. M. Tsukada's co-authors include Yoshihiro Shimazu, Akira Misawa, Masataka Sunagawa, Ken-ichi Yukimatsu, Yuichi Ohta, Yuki Yamada, K. Habara, Tadashi Hisamitsu, Koji Sasayama and H. Nakano and has published in prestigious journals such as SHILAP Revista de lepidopterología, IEEE Journal on Selected Areas in Communications and Journal of Ethnopharmacology.
